The city of martyrs – that’s what Mariupol called the Pope. It has remained the hottest spot since Russia’s full-scale war against Ukraine.

The Russian occupiers blocked Mariupol in early March. During this time, they almost razed it to the ground, destroying about 95-98% of all buildings.

During the siege of the city at the hands of the Russian occupiers killed more than 20 thousand people. This is twice as much as in the two years of occupation during World War II. More than 40,000 people were forcibly deported to Russia or the so-called DNR.

Watching now

According to Mariupol Mayor’s Adviser Petro Andryushchenko, today the occupiers are turning Mariupol into a real ghetto. People are being bullied, they are completely powerless. Locals pass through filtration camps and are driven to new neighborhoods where they can still live.

The city lives without water and food, and there are many mass graves with civilians. Therefore, people are forced to work for food, dismantle debris, remove the bodies of the dead from the debris, from the streets.

For a long time, the hottest spot in Mariupol is the Azovstal metallurgical plant. Since the beginning of the blockade, not only Ukrainian soldiers have been on its territory, but also hundreds of civilians who have been hiding from constant Russian shelling in the plant’s bomb shelters.

On May 7, Iryna Vereshchuk, Minister for the Reintegration of the Temporarily Occupied Territories, said that all civilian women, children and the elderly had been evacuated from Azovstal. However, our military remains there, including the wounded, who need to be evacuated.

But on May 8, Azov Regiment Intelligence Officer Ilya Samoilenko told a news conference that civilians could still remain at the Azovstal plant. According to him, this information is still being clarified.

March 1, 2022 – blockade of Mariupol

Russian troops surrounded the city. Since then, hundreds of thousands of people have come under regular fire without access to water, heat and food, without mobile communications and safe access.

People were left without heating when the temperature in Mariupol was minus.

March 9, 2022 – Russian troops bomb a hospital and maternity hospital in Mariupol.

The Russians completely destroyed the maternity hospital №3 and partially the hospital (children’s ward and therapy). Several bombs were dropped on the hospital during an enemy airstrike.

The footage, which instantly flew around the world, shows that the building was very badly damaged. People on stretchers were taken out of the house and pregnant women were taken out.

As a result of the air strike, 17 people were injured and 3 died (among them a little girl).

March 16, 2022 – the occupiers dropped a bomb on the Drama Theater.

Many locals with small children hid in its premises and bomb shelter. The theater was a shelter where people escaped the shelling.

According to official information, at least 300 people were killed during the bombing by the Russian occupiers of the Drama Theater in Mariupol.

However, an investigation by the Associated Press found evidence that the attack was in fact much more deadly, killing about 600 people.

Mid-April 2022 – some Ukrainian Marines were able to join forces with Azov in Azovstal.

After this operation of our military, Russia focused all its efforts on destroying the last stronghold of Ukrainian defenders in Mariupol – the Azovstal plant.

Heavy bombs and free-falling bombs are dropped on the plant every day. Various artillery is also used for the assault. But even in such inhumane conditions, our defenders are trying to maintain their fighting spirit.

In complete darkness in the bomb shelter, they perform the anthem of the Ukrainian army. We were born at a great hour, hoping that the light will overcome this darkness.

April 27, 2022 – defenders of Mariupol ask for extraction

The commander of the 36th Separate Marine Brigade of the Navy, Serhiy Volynsky (Volyna), asked to save the Mariupol garrison and conduct an extraction based on the 1940 operation in Dunkirk.

He stressed that there are hundreds of wounded soldiers of varying severity in the territory of Azovstal. They are in dire need of medical care. And at the plant there are no conditions, no medicines, no staff who could help them.

The wounded die in unbearable torment every day, because medicines, disinfectants, anesthesia are long gone.

* The extraction procedure involves the removal of military and civilians from the scene of hostilities to a safe zone (in the territory of a third country or in the territory controlled by Ukraine).

It is used when there is a threat of losing control of the city, which could lead to the destruction of personnel.

Beginning of May 2022 – civilians were deported from Azovstal.

On May 1, Iryna Vereshchuk, the Minister for Reintegration of the Temporarily Occupied Territories, said that more than 100 women, children and the elderly had been evacuated from Azovstal in the first two days.

May 4, 2022 – the storming of Azovstal

The head of the Ukrainian delegation at the talks with Russia, David Arakhamiya, said that attempts to storm the plant were ongoing for the second day. Russian troops broke into the territory of Azovstal.

On the same day, Azov confirmed that the situation on the territory of the plant is extremely difficult, heavy fighting continues, but the Ukrainian military continues to defend itself.

May 6, 2022 – The occupiers fired on an evacuation vehicle.

During the ceasefire on Azovstal, the Russians lined up a car using ATGM. This car was being driven to evacuate civilians from the plant.

Then three Ukrainian defenders were killed and six more of our soldiers were wounded.

On the same day, the head of the President’s Office, Andriy Yermak, said that almost 500 civilians had been evacuated from Mariupol and Azovstal.

May 7, 2022 – All women, children and the elderly were deported from Azovstal.

According to Iryna Vereshchuk, all women, children and the elderly were evacuated from Azovstal. This part of the Mariupol humanitarian operation has been completed.

Currently, Ukrainian defenders remain at the Azovstal plant. They continue to defend themselves, but call on the world to save them.

On May 7, Serhiy Volynskyi, commander of the 36th Marine Brigade of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, reiterated that time was running out, so the defenders of Mariupol needed to be evacuated immediately.

Meanwhile,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y said that Ukraine was preparing for the second stage of evacuation of medics and wounded from Mariupol after the successful completion of the first part of the humanitarian operation.

According to him, the authorities are working to release servicemen from the Mariupol metallurgical plant, but this is extremely difficult.

At the same time, the General Staff of the Armed Forces of Ukraine announced on the morning of May 8 that the Russians were bringing equipment to Mariupol. According to our military, Russia seeks to meet the needs of a group of its troops focused on the Mariupol direction.

Therefore, the Russian army continues to block Ukrainian units near the Azovstal plant. The invaders carried out assault operations with the support of artillery and tanks.
